Abstract

The present invention relates to a kind of herbage processing equipment, more particularly to a kind of livestock breed aquatics herbage processing equipment.The technical problem to be solved in the present invention is to provide a kind for the treatment of effeciency height, and processing speed is fast, easy to operate livestock breed aquatics herbage processing equipment.In order to solve above-mentioned technical problem, the invention provides such a livestock breed aquatics herbage processing equipment, includes base plate, left frame, the first slide rail, the first slide block, processing block, right shelf, fix bar, the first flat belt, first gear, hinge member, first connecting rod etc.;Base plate top left side is welded with left frame, and left frame right upper portion is welded with two fixed mounts, and the mode being bolted on the right side of two fixed mounts is connected with the second slide rail.Invention achieves treatment effeciency high, processing speed is fast, easy to operate effect, this equipment can reduce the machine maintenance time, can save substantial amounts of artificial, and treatment effect is good.

Preferably, the first motor is servomotor.
Operation principle:When needing to process herbage, staff pours herbage into process inframe first, then, The first motor rotate counterclockwise is controlled, the first motor drives the second belt pulley rotate counterclockwise, on the one hand, the second belt pulley passes through Second flat belt drives the 3rd belt pulley rotate counterclockwise, and then drives the second rotating shaft rotate counterclockwise, so as to drive second not Gear rotate counterclockwise, when the gear teeth of the second partial gear bottom are engaged with the first partial gear, drives first completely Clockwise, as tooth bar is engaged with the first partial gear, and then band carry-over bar is moved partial gear upwards, so as to the company of drive Extension bar is moved upwards, and connecting rod drives cutting knife to move upwards, and now, the 3rd belt pulley drives the second rotating shaft to continue to revolve counterclockwise Turn, the second rotating shaft drives the second partial gear rotate counterclockwise, when the gear teeth on the second partial gear top are engaged with tooth bar When, the second partial gear band carry-over bar is moved downward, and then drives connecting rod to move downward, so as to drive cutting knife to transport downwards Dynamic, so repeatedly so that cutting knife carries out quick chopping process to herbage, on the other hand, the second belt pulley passes through the first flat belt The first belt pulley rotate counterclockwise is driven, the first belt pulley drives second gear rotate counterclockwise, and then drives second connecting rod inverse Hour hands rotate, and as second gear is engaged with first gear, when second gear rotate counterclockwise, drive first gear clockwise Rotation, so as to drive first connecting rod to turn clockwise, drives fixed block or so fortune under the cooperation of first connecting rod and second connecting rod Dynamic, fixed block drives processing block side-to-side movement, and so repeatedly, the herbage for processing inframe is stirred, and is made under the cooperation of cutting knife Obtain herbage to be rendered adequately treated quite quickly.After the completion of process, the first motor of control stops rotate counterclockwise, and staff is by herding for handling well Grass is collected.
Because hinge member also includes rotary shaft and fastening lid, in first gear, eccentric position and first connecting rod right-hand member are equal Through hole is provided with, after rotary shaft passes through the through hole in first gear on eccentric position and first connecting rod right-hand member, fastening lid and rotary shaft End interference connection, in second gear, eccentric position and second connecting rod right-hand member are provided with through hole, and rotary shaft is inclined through in second gear Through hole on heart position and second connecting rod right-hand member, on fixed block and first connecting rod and second connecting rod left end are provided with through hole, rotates Axle is passed through on fixed block and first connecting rod and the through hole on second connecting rod left end, and fastening lid is connected with rotation shaft rear end interference, should Hinge member is more flexible so that service life of equipment is more long.
Because also including spring and baffle plate, left frame lower right side is connected with spring, spring by way of linking up with connection Right-hand member is connected with baffle plate by way of linking up with connection, and baffle plate is located on the left of processing block, when processing block to left movement to a certain degree When, baffle plate is extruded, and spring is compressed, when processing block is moved right leaves baffle plate, baffle plate spring elastic force effect under to Right motion impact processing block, the herbage for processing inframe are stirred, and reach the quick effect for processing herbage.
Because also including reinforcement right shelf left upper portion is welded with reinforcement, reinforcement left end is welded with top board bottom right Connect, the stability between right shelf and top board can be increased.
Because baseboard material is rustless steel, rustless steel corrosion resistance and acid resistance are strong, can extension device service life.
Because left frame material is Q235 steel, Q235 steel hardness is high, and is unlikely to deform, and makes the service life of this equipment longer.
Because the first motor is servomotor, anti-overload ability is strong, and high speed performance is good, can be precisely controlled its rotating speed.
